Hypertable has stopped its further development with March 2016 and is removed from the DB-Engines ranking.
DescriptionOpen-source analytics data store designed for sub-second OLAP queries on high dimensionality and high cardinality dataLarge scale data warehouse service with append-only tablesAn open source BigTable implementation based on distributed file systems such as HadoopAn embeddable, non-blocking, type-safe key-value store for single or multiple disks and in-memory storage
